If the residents of Apes’ Den are pleased to see a larger than usual number of Britons snapping them, cooing over them or, indeed, edging gingerly away from them, they give little indication of it.
It is not much of a stretch to suggest that the social, political and economic ramifications of the current pandemic have been wholly lost on the crag-haunting, tourist-attracting Barbary macaques as they lounge around their lair high above the busy streets and marinas of Gibraltar.
The small but admirably menacing primates do what they always do: they skulk, squabble, snooze and groom each other – and study their visitors
